In this episode, we’re joined by Roeland Delrue, Co-founder of Aikido Security, the fast-growing application security platform that just became a unicorn in under 4 years.
Roeland shares what it really takes to scale a company at breakneck speed, from going 5× year-over-year, to balancing startups and enterprise in one GTM motion, to raising a Series B with a single goal: becoming “unignorable.” We unpack how Aikido uses product-led growth, brutal revenue focus, and buyer-first sales mentality to win in one of the most competitive markets in SaaS.
We spoke with Roeland about building for continuous wins, why revenue clarity beats buzzwords, and how Aikido joins the buyer’s journey instead of forcing rigid sales methodologies.
Here are some of the key questions we address:
- How did Aikido grow from $5M to $20M+ ARR in one year?
- What does it mean to build an unignorable company?
- Why brutal focus on revenue simplifies product, hiring, and prioritization decisions
- Why joining the buyer’s journey beats forcing MEDDICC-style sales processes
- How product-led trials reduce churn and increase win rates
- What it takes to scale from unicorn to decacorn (and why $100M ARR is the next real milestone)
